Transaction 66e4c8860f071276efb7c6b7aa67ada744ab8e05b7907b616dd3dd6e0f379270
1 Input
1 Output
-
66e4c8860f071276efb7c6b7aa67ada744ab8e05b7907b616dd3dd6e0f379270:0
- value
- 10662211
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8e6ec984231bc70521fe6334c32b5e7d488f260 OP_EQUAL
- address
- 3NvVKweV32F8i41xZ5e6s3Gef3kWiiP3QK